Text to Speech Software Definition

Text-to-Speech (TTS) software refers to programs or systems that convert written text into spoken words. These applications enable digital devices to read aloud content, making it accessible to users in various contexts.
This technology is commonly used for:
- Accessibility for individuals with visual impairments
- Voice assistants in smartphones and smart speakers
- Learning tools for language education
- Reading content aloud for multitasking
Key features of TTS software include:
- Natural-sounding voices
- Customizable speech rate and pitch
- Multilingual support
- Integration with various applications and devices
TTS software aims to enhance user interaction by providing auditory feedback, improving accessibility, and simplifying complex processes for people with reading challenges.
Common TTS technologies are based on:
Technology | Description |
---|---|
Concatenative synthesis | Uses recorded speech segments to form words and sentences. |
Parametric synthesis | Generates speech from mathematical models, offering more flexibility. |
Neural synthesis | Utilizes AI to produce human-like voices based on deep learning models. |
Understanding the Core Functionality of Text to Speech Software
Text to speech (TTS) technology converts written text into audible speech. It is commonly used to assist those with visual impairments, language learners, and even to improve the accessibility of content. The software works by analyzing input text and generating natural-sounding audio using a variety of linguistic and speech synthesis methods.
The primary function of TTS software is to interpret written content and convert it into spoken words. This process involves several key components, such as linguistic analysis, phonetic transcription, and sound generation. The quality of the output can vary depending on the algorithms and voice databases used by the software.
Key Features and Processes of TTS Software
- Text Analysis: The software first processes the text to understand its structure, including punctuation and grammar.
- Phonetic Transcription: The text is then converted into phonetic symbols that represent how the words should be pronounced.
- Speech Synthesis: Using pre-recorded voice samples or artificial intelligence, the software generates the speech from the phonetic transcription.
"The performance of TTS systems heavily relies on the underlying algorithms, voice quality, and customization options."
Types of Speech Synthesis Used in TTS
- Concatenative Synthesis: This method uses a large database of recorded human voices to splice together individual sound units (phonemes) to form words and sentences.
- Formant Synthesis: This technique generates speech sounds using mathematical models of the human vocal tract, offering greater flexibility but often sounding less natural.
- Parametric Synthesis: AI-driven methods generate speech by controlling various parameters like pitch, speed, and tone based on statistical models.
Performance Metrics in TTS
Metric | Description |
---|---|
Naturalness | The degree to which the generated speech sounds like a human voice. |
Intelligibility | The clarity with which the speech can be understood by the listener. |
Real-time Processing | The ability to generate speech with minimal delay, important for live interactions. |
How Text to Speech Software Enhances Accessibility for Users with Disabilities
Text to speech (TTS) technology plays a critical role in improving accessibility for individuals with various disabilities. It allows users to convert written content into spoken words, making information more accessible to those who may have difficulty reading or understanding text. This technology is particularly beneficial for individuals with visual impairments, dyslexia, or cognitive disabilities. By converting text into audio, TTS software provides an alternative way for users to interact with digital content, ensuring they can access information efficiently and independently.
Moreover, TTS software offers a wide range of customization features, such as voice selection, speed control, and pitch adjustment. This makes it adaptable to the needs of different users, ensuring that the software is usable by people with varying preferences and requirements. As a result, TTS technology not only improves accessibility but also promotes inclusivity, giving users the tools they need to engage with digital platforms in ways that best suit their abilities.
Key Benefits for Users with Disabilities
- Support for Visual Impairments: TTS software converts written text into speech, allowing individuals with visual impairments to access digital content without needing to rely on sight.
- Improvement for Users with Dyslexia: TTS technology helps individuals with dyslexia by providing auditory support to aid in reading comprehension and reducing cognitive strain.
- Cognitive and Learning Disabilities: TTS enables users with cognitive challenges to process information more effectively by allowing them to listen and follow along with the text.
- Hands-Free Interaction: TTS software allows users to listen to content without needing to focus on reading, providing a more hands-free interaction that is particularly useful for those with mobility impairments.
How TTS Enhances Digital Interaction
- Personalized User Experience: Users can adjust the voice speed, tone, and language settings to match their preferences, ensuring that the software is tailored to their specific needs.
- Integration with Other Technologies: TTS can be integrated with screen readers, voice assistants, and other accessibility tools, enhancing overall user experience.
- Improved Educational Accessibility: TTS helps students with disabilities by providing audio versions of textbooks, assignments, and other learning materials, making education more inclusive.
Practical Applications of TTS for Users with Disabilities
Disability | How TTS Helps |
---|---|
Visual Impairment | Reads aloud written content, allowing users to access websites, documents, and other text-based information. |
Dyslexia | Assists with reading comprehension by converting text into speech, reducing decoding difficulties. |
Cognitive Disabilities | Supports understanding of complex information by providing auditory cues alongside written content. |
Mobility Impairments | Offers a hands-free method of interacting with text, enabling users to access information without manual input. |
Text-to-speech software is an invaluable tool that bridges the gap between people with disabilities and the digital world, ensuring that everyone has equal access to information and opportunities for learning and growth.
Choosing the Right Text-to-Speech Solution for Your Business
When selecting a text-to-speech (TTS) solution for your business, it's crucial to evaluate both functional and technical aspects that align with your organization's needs. With a variety of options available, businesses must weigh factors such as voice quality, customization features, and ease of integration into existing systems. The goal is to select a tool that not only enhances customer experience but also improves efficiency across different departments.
The ideal TTS software should provide clear, natural-sounding speech, ease of use, and support for multiple languages or dialects if required. A well-chosen TTS solution can boost accessibility, create new communication channels, and streamline customer support processes. Below are some key aspects to consider when making your decision.
Key Considerations When Choosing TTS Software
- Voice Quality: Ensure that the software offers high-quality, natural-sounding voices. This helps avoid robotic or unnatural speech patterns, which can negatively impact user experience.
- Customization: Look for software that allows you to adjust parameters such as speed, pitch, and tone to suit your specific needs.
- Language and Accent Support: Choose a TTS solution that offers support for multiple languages and regional accents to ensure inclusivity and broader customer reach.
- Integration: Check if the solution integrates seamlessly with your existing software infrastructure, such as customer relationship management (CRM) systems and chatbots.
It's important to test the software with real-world data to see how well it performs with your content and workload.
Steps to Evaluate the Right TTS Software
- Define Your Objectives: Identify whether your primary goal is improving accessibility, automating customer service, or integrating TTS with other systems.
- Assess Scalability: Ensure the solution can grow with your business, accommodating increasing demand and evolving technology.
- Trial Period: Make use of free trials to evaluate voice quality, customization, and compatibility with your workflows before committing to a long-term solution.
Comparison of Popular TTS Software Solutions
Software | Voice Quality | Customization | Language Support |
---|---|---|---|
Solution A | High | Extensive | Multiple languages |
Solution B | Medium | Basic | Limited languages |
Solution C | Excellent | Advanced | Wide range of languages |
Integration of Text to Speech Technology with Existing Applications
Integrating Text to Speech (TTS) technology into existing software systems allows applications to become more accessible and interactive, bridging the gap between text and auditory experiences. This process typically involves incorporating an external TTS API or embedding a local TTS engine to convert written content into speech. By adding this functionality, developers enhance the user experience, particularly for individuals with visual impairments or those who prefer auditory interaction over reading.
Application developers can integrate TTS technology in various contexts, ranging from simple text-reading features in mobile apps to complex, voice-interactive systems. The integration method depends on the platform and specific requirements of the software, ensuring flexibility in how TTS is implemented to meet different use cases.
Key Considerations for TTS Integration
- API Selection: Choose between cloud-based or on-premise solutions based on cost, data privacy, and performance needs.
- Voice Customization: Ensure that the speech output aligns with the brand's tone and supports multiple languages if needed.
- Compatibility: Verify that the TTS system works seamlessly with the target application’s environment (e.g., mobile, desktop, web).
- Latency and Performance: Minimize delays in speech synthesis for a smooth user experience, especially in real-time applications.
Common TTS Integration Scenarios
- Accessibility Enhancements: Adding TTS to reading apps, websites, or documents to support visually impaired users.
- Customer Service Systems: Integrating TTS into chatbots or virtual assistants for more human-like interactions.
- Education Tools: Enabling TTS for language learning or interactive e-learning platforms to vocalize text content.
"Integrating TTS can provide significant advantages in terms of user experience, engagement, and accessibility, making applications more inclusive for diverse audiences."
Implementation Strategy
Incorporating TTS can be broken down into key steps for efficient integration:
Step | Description |
---|---|
1. Select TTS Service | Choose between cloud or local TTS solutions based on needs for scalability and performance. |
2. Configure Voice Settings | Customize voice parameters such as speed, pitch, and language preferences to match the application’s context. |
3. Embed into Application | Integrate the TTS API or engine into the existing codebase to enable text-to-speech functionality. |
4. Test and Optimize | Ensure the speech output is clear, accurate, and synchronized with the user interface for a seamless experience. |
How Text to Speech Enhances Customer Experience in Service Sectors
Text-to-speech (TTS) technology plays a crucial role in transforming customer interactions within service industries, enhancing accessibility and streamlining communication. By converting written text into natural-sounding speech, TTS enables businesses to offer real-time support and personalized assistance to their customers. This capability not only enhances the user experience but also optimizes operational efficiency, making services more responsive and engaging.
In sectors such as retail, banking, and healthcare, TTS systems are becoming increasingly integral. These industries leverage the technology to provide 24/7 customer support, automate routine queries, and create more interactive interfaces for users. The result is a smoother, faster, and more satisfying customer journey that builds trust and loyalty.
Key Benefits of TTS in Service Industries
- Accessibility: TTS allows visually impaired or differently-abled individuals to interact more easily with digital interfaces.
- Personalized Experience: Through voice-enabled responses, businesses can provide tailored information and engage customers more effectively.
- Efficiency: Automated voice interactions speed up processes like appointment scheduling, inquiries, and transactional services.
- Cost-Effectiveness: Automating routine customer service tasks with TTS reduces the need for live agents, cutting operational costs.
"TTS technology allows businesses to connect with customers more effectively, offering a level of service that is both fast and inclusive."
Examples of TTS Use in Service Sectors
- Customer Support in Retail: Chatbots and virtual assistants powered by TTS answer customer queries, guide product selections, and provide order status updates in a human-like voice.
- Banking Services: TTS is used in mobile apps and phone services to assist customers with account balances, transactions, and loan inquiries.
- Healthcare Communication: Hospitals use TTS to deliver appointment reminders, medication instructions, and emergency alerts to patients in real-time.
Comparison of TTS Solutions for Service Industries
Feature | Basic TTS | Advanced TTS with AI |
---|---|---|
Voice Naturalness | Mechanical | Human-like |
Personalization | Limited | Contextual adaptation |
Multi-language Support | Basic | Extensive |
Real-time Feedback | No | Yes |
Understanding Voice Customization Features in Text to Speech Software
Text-to-speech software has evolved to provide a high degree of personalization, allowing users to modify the voice characteristics to match specific needs. These features are particularly beneficial for enhancing user experience, especially for accessibility purposes, professional voiceovers, or even for creating virtual assistants. By adjusting voice parameters, users can achieve a more natural or preferred vocal output for different scenarios.
Voice customization includes a wide range of features, such as pitch, speed, volume, and accent modifications. These options are valuable for tailoring the speech to individual preferences, making it sound more human-like or suited to a particular audience. The flexibility in altering these parameters contributes to the software's adaptability across various use cases, from e-learning applications to audio content creation.
Key Voice Customization Features
- Pitch Adjustment: Alters the highness or lowness of the voice.
- Speed Control: Adjusts how quickly the text is spoken.
- Volume Control: Modifies the loudness of the generated speech.
- Accents and Languages: Offers different regional pronunciations and language options.
- Voice Gender: Selects between male, female, or other neutral vocal types.
Customizable Voice Selection Options
- Select from a range of predefined voice models.
- Fine-tune the characteristics of a specific voice by adjusting pitch, speed, and other parameters.
- Import custom voice data for more personalized outputs.
"Customization of voice parameters in text-to-speech systems can greatly enhance user satisfaction by offering a more dynamic and context-appropriate speech output."
Comparison of Voice Customization Capabilities
Feature | Standard Options | Advanced Options |
---|---|---|
Voice Gender | Male, Female | Neutral, Custom Voices |
Speed | Normal, Fast | Slow, Variable Speed |
Pitch | Low, High | Custom Range |
Accents | Standard Accents | Regional Variants, Custom Accents |
How Text to Speech Software Facilitates Multilingual Communication
Text to speech (TTS) technology plays a pivotal role in overcoming language barriers in communication. It allows users to listen to written content in different languages, which is especially valuable in our increasingly globalized world. This capability helps to bridge the gap between people who speak different languages, enabling more efficient and effective interactions across cultures and regions.
By converting text into natural-sounding speech, TTS software offers significant advantages for multilingual communication. It allows individuals who are not fluent in certain languages to comprehend content without requiring full proficiency in reading and writing that language. TTS is particularly useful in areas such as education, business, customer service, and travel.
Key Advantages of TTS in Multilingual Settings
- Accessibility: TTS makes content accessible to people with disabilities, such as those with visual impairments or reading difficulties, by reading out text in multiple languages.
- Language Learning: TTS supports language learners by providing correct pronunciation and enhancing listening skills.
- Real-Time Translation: TTS can help in real-time communication between speakers of different languages by offering immediate spoken translation.
How TTS Software Improves Multilingual Interactions
- Cross-Cultural Communication: TTS ensures that written content, whether in emails, documents, or websites, is accessible in spoken form in multiple languages.
- Global Customer Support: TTS enables businesses to offer customer support in different languages, making services more inclusive.
- Enhancing Travel Experiences: TTS applications assist travelers by reading out signs, menus, and directions in foreign languages.
"The integration of Text to Speech in multilingual communication has revolutionized how people engage with content across various languages, offering new opportunities for interaction and accessibility."
Supported Languages in TTS Software
Language | Availability |
---|---|
English | Widely supported |
Spanish | Widely supported |
Chinese | Supported in major platforms |
French | Widely supported |
Arabic | Available in many TTS systems |
Top Security Considerations When Using Text to Speech Software in Business
As businesses increasingly integrate Text to Speech (TTS) software into their operations, it is essential to address various security concerns to protect sensitive data and ensure compliance with privacy regulations. TTS systems often handle large volumes of personal and corporate information, which can be vulnerable to breaches if not properly secured. Therefore, understanding the potential risks and applying appropriate safeguards is critical for maintaining business integrity and confidentiality.
With TTS solutions being used for everything from customer service interactions to internal communications, it’s important to focus on key security aspects to mitigate threats. Businesses must prioritize encryption, access control, and data integrity measures to prevent unauthorized access and ensure the secure processing of voice data.
Security Factors to Consider
- Data Encryption: Ensure that all voice data is encrypted both in transit and at rest to protect sensitive information from being intercepted or accessed by unauthorized individuals.
- Access Control: Implement strict access controls to limit who can interact with TTS systems. This can help prevent malicious actors from tampering with voice outputs or extracting confidential information.
- Voice Data Privacy: TTS systems often process personal or confidential voice data. Businesses must assess whether this data needs to be anonymized to comply with privacy laws such as GDPR or HIPAA.
- Software Updates and Patches: Regular updates to TTS software are necessary to fix vulnerabilities. Failure to maintain up-to-date software can leave the system open to exploitation.
Mitigating Risks
- Regular Audits: Conduct regular security audits of TTS systems to identify potential weaknesses and ensure compliance with security policies.
- User Education: Train employees on the secure use of TTS tools, emphasizing the importance of maintaining data security and privacy when interacting with these systems.
- Authentication Mechanisms: Use multi-factor authentication (MFA) to ensure that only authorized personnel can access or configure the TTS software.
"Security should be an integral part of the TTS implementation process. Protecting sensitive data and ensuring compliance with privacy regulations will not only safeguard your business but also build trust with customers."
Security Measure | Impact |
---|---|
Data Encryption | Prevents unauthorized access to sensitive information during transmission and storage. |
Access Control | Limits system access to authorized users, reducing the risk of malicious activity. |
Regular Software Updates | Ensures that vulnerabilities are patched, reducing the likelihood of system exploitation. |